I feel like it wouldn’t be hard to find a team to do retention on subban. He was only due 2M going into the season (the rest of this years pay was bonus). So with half the season gone he’s only due 1M so devils retain 50% (4.5M caphit but 500K actual dollars) and teamX retains another 50% (2.25M caphit but only 250K actual dollars). So in terms of retention sure it’s a big caphit but not a huge financial burden
